首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android音乐播放器App添加Shuffle,Repeat & Random

是为了提供更好的音乐播放体验和功能。下面是对这些功能的详细解释:

  1. Shuffle(随机播放):Shuffle功能可以随机播放音乐列表中的歌曲,使得每次播放的顺序都不同。这样可以带来更多的惊喜和多样性,让用户可以发现和欣赏不同的音乐作品。推荐的腾讯云相关产品是腾讯云音乐,它是一款在线音乐播放器,提供了丰富的音乐资源和个性化推荐功能。产品介绍链接地址:https://y.qq.com/
  2. Repeat(重复播放):Repeat功能可以让用户选择是否重复播放当前歌曲或整个音乐列表。用户可以根据自己的喜好和需求,选择单曲循环、列表循环或关闭重复播放功能。这样可以让用户反复聆听自己喜欢的音乐,加深对音乐的理解和感受。
  3. Random(随机模式):Random功能可以在音乐列表中随机选择一首歌曲进行播放。与Shuffle功能不同的是,Random功能只会随机选择一首歌曲进行播放,而不是整个列表。这样可以让用户在不想听整个列表的情况下,随机选择一首歌曲进行欣赏。

这些功能在Android音乐播放器App中的应用场景非常广泛。用户可以根据自己的喜好和心情,选择不同的播放模式来享受音乐。例如,在开车、运动、工作或休闲的时候,用户可以选择Shuffle功能来随机播放音乐,带来更多的惊喜和放松。而在学习、专注或睡眠的时候,用户可以选择Repeat功能来重复播放某首歌曲或整个列表,帮助集中注意力或放松身心。

总结起来,Android音乐播放器App的Shuffle、Repeat和Random功能为用户提供了更多的选择和个性化体验,让用户可以根据自己的喜好和需求来享受音乐。腾讯云音乐是一款推荐的腾讯云相关产品,它提供了丰富的音乐资源和个性化推荐功能,可以满足用户对音乐的不同需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

HTML5+Ajax实现音乐播放器

本文播放器音乐是通过豆瓣FM的API获取到的。Demo美观简单,可自行扩展其功能,本文作者「张新望zxw 」,来源于「简书 」,已经获得转载许可,点击「阅读原文」就可以跳转原地址。...播放器音乐是通过豆瓣FM的API获取到的,我们可以随机的听到豆瓣FM的任何音乐。(这些API是饥人谷的老师整理的),音乐播放器美观如图: ?...html+js源代码 css源代码 公众号回复:音乐播放器 html部分 代码: <!...{ var channels = response.channels; var num = Math.floor(Math.random...然后我们需要在js文件结尾加上$(document).ready(getChannel())代码让浏览器预加载播放器。这里基本已经把播放器完成了,功能比较简单。有兴趣的同学可以自己再添加功能。

9.2K40

YouTube开源播放器中文使用指南

指的是出版者用来控制被保护对象的使用权的一些技术,这些技术保护的有数字化内容(例如:软件、音乐、电影)。...缺点 相比于Android原生的MediaPlayer,ExoPlayer将显著的消耗更多的电量 集成ExoPlayer将对你的APP包体增加几百KB的大小 叁·支持设备的情况 ExoPlayer...支持大部分流媒体格式,并且对DRM的支持也比较友好,比如下方就是官方提供的支持的设备情况: 用例 Android版本号 Android API Level Audio Playback 4.1 16 Video...() } 在app module的build.gradle中添加对ExoPlayer的依赖: implementation 'com.google.android.exoplayer:exoplayer...concatenatingMediaSource = new ConcatenatingMediaSource(mediaSources); mExoPlayer.setRepeatMode(Player.REPEAT_MODE_ALL

3.8K20

Android Studio如何实现音乐播放器(简单易上手)

音乐带给人的听觉享受是无可比拟的,动听的音乐可以愉悦人的身心,让人更加积极地去热爱生活。大家平常应该会用QQ音乐、网易云音乐或者酷狗音乐音乐APP来听歌,想不想拥有属于自己的音乐播放器。...那么接下来就教大家如何用Android Studio自己制作一个音乐播放器APP。...activity_main为MainActivity的布局文件,显示运行APP时的主界面。 activity_music为MusicActivity的布局文件,显示音乐播放器界面。...music_list和item_layout一起组成frag1的布局文件, 就是音乐列表界面(打开APP默认显示音乐列表界面)。...player=new MediaPlayer(); } //添加计时器用于设置音乐播放器中的播放进度条 public void addTimer(){

6.3K22

使用vue互联QQ音乐完成网站音乐播放器

---- 文章简介:使用vue互联QQ音乐完成网站音乐播放器 创作目的:记录使用APlayer播放器+MetingJs实现 在线播放qq音乐、网易云音…等平台的音乐 ☀️ 今日天气:2022...3-3-1、在控制台输入命令启动vue项目 3-3-2、通过package.js启动项目 4、音乐播放器歌曲播放源切换 4-1、QQ音乐歌单播放 4-1-1、获取QQ音乐歌单id 4-1-...2、APlayer 和 MetingJS 的简单介绍 2-1、APlayer开源音乐播放器 Aplayer是一个功能强大的HTML5音乐播放器, 开源地址:https://github.com/...,值:“all”,one”,“none” order(顺序) list 播放器播放顺序,值:“list”,“random” preload(加载) auto 值:“none”,“metadata”,“'...然后我门在div内部添加如下代码 <meting-js id="8692248848" server="tencent" type="playlist

2.7K40

android音乐播放简单实现的简单示例(MediaPlayer)

利用MediaPlayer完成一个最简单的音乐播放。这个基本的控制掌握后,可直接利用为背景乐的控制。...private MediaPlayer mediaPlayer = new MediaPlayer(); 由于音乐播放也是需要专门的权限的,所以在 onCreate 中动态申请权限,然后才初始化播放器。...如果没有这条语句,实测的效果是点击了停止按钮后,再点击开始按钮是无法顺利播放音乐的。感兴趣的朋友可以实验一下。 onDestroy() 的逻辑很容易理解,就是彻底清理音乐播放占用的资源了。...; import android.support.annotation.NonNull; import android.support.v4.app.ActivityCompat; import android.support.v4....content.ContextCompat; import android.support.v7.app.AppCompatActivity; import android.os.Bundle; import

3.4K31

Android基于MediaBroswerService的App实现概述

前言 如何实现一个音乐播放App,然后让其可以被第三方的Android app打开,并获取其中的歌单,曲目列表,同时控制其播放呢?现有应用市场上,已经有相应的实现。...image.png 在百度的Carlife App中,我们可以看到,只要我们本地的装了QQ音乐App,其就可以唤起,然后获取其中的歌曲数据,然后进行播放,这个是如何实现的呢?...需求 可以获取音乐播放器的歌曲列表 可以控制音乐播放器的播放 可以将音乐播放器的状态同步到第三方App 能够和第三方App间进行相互通信 类似于CarLife 对音乐App的唤起,首先第三方App开启后...,即可拉起音乐App,然后获取其中的歌单,打开歌单之后,获取歌单内的歌曲列表,点击进行播放,可以进行播放,暂停,下一首,上一首的控制。...当使用一个media contoller和Session的时候,我们可以在运行期部署多个播放器,在其执行的时候根据设备去修改app的外观。

1.8K30

Android小程序实现音乐播放列表

} @Override public void onUpgrade(SQLiteDatabase db, int oldVersion, int newVersion) { } } (2)创建添加音乐的...AddActivity,添加界面提供两个文本框和一个按钮,用于输入音乐名和歌手名,当单击“添加”按钮时,将数据插入到表中,具体代码如下: package com.example.musiclist;...android.app.AlertDialog; import android.app.ListActivity; import android.content.DialogInterface; import..." android:textSize="25px"/ </LinearLayout 运行程序,添加音乐信息: ?...在音乐列表中单击一条记录,弹出警告对话框删除一条记录: ? 更多关于播放器的内容请点击《java播放器功能》进行学习。 以上就是本文的全部内容,希望对大家的学习有所帮助。

1.2K41

Android开发—-简单几步教你制作一个简易的音乐播放器

前言:本博文只教你编程的思想,就举一个简单的例子来实现我们的简易的音乐播放器,大家不喜勿喷啊 友情提示:本博文用到的是Android Studio进行开发的,软件安装教程:Android Studio...>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com...:text="钉钉音乐播放器" android:textColor="?...: 在音乐播放界面,我是用的是布局的嵌套,LinearLayout布局中进行嵌套LinearLayout布局,加以TextView和imageview控件,也不知道我的审美怎样,咱们做的是最简易的音乐播放器...---- 这样简单地一个音乐播放器就做好了,喜欢的朋友可以看看,觉得那块有问题了可以在评论区打出来,大家一块研究研究呀,谢谢大家喽 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n

1.9K10

使用react-native实现一个音乐播放器

程序员怎么甘于堕落到被他人限制不能听音乐! 于是就有了下面这个app....需求说明: 我需要一个播放器,可以播放我本地的音乐,并且给这些音乐分类,我点哪个音乐集就播放哪个音乐集.数据不需要保存到服务器上,保存本地即可.UI不需要好看,功能能正常使用就可以. github开源处...2.拉取本地音乐页面(已拉取) ? 3.未拉取 ? 4.点击歌集播放音乐 ? 5.添加歌集页面 ?...我想说的是,在最开始的时候,我有尝试过flutter,我也有认真的去学习他的语法知识,就是为了简单的写出几个列表,最后也写出来了.但是当我真正准备去开发这个app的时候,问题来了,如何获取本地的音乐列表呢...如果播放这些音乐呢? 我也找了有一段时间了,发现没有合适的api或者合适的组件库,反而让我找到react-native相关的. 于是便采用了react-native来开发我这个music播放器.

2.6K10

Android 课设之个人音乐播放器

第一章 绪论 1.1选题背景 由于时代快速发展,各种各样的音乐播放器层出不穷,此时需要一个可以根据个人爱好来播放的音乐播放器就尤为重要,因此我特意制作了一个根据自己喜好的音乐播放器,只需要把音乐文件放进制定的目录下即可...1.2开发技术 该App利用了SQlite数据库对于用户的管理,还有MediaPlayer媒体播放器的使用,和各种布局加以一些控件得以使界面看着舒服,还有利用了广播信息对于用户的操作进行提示。...Protect void onCreate(Bundle): 构建播放音乐界面 Public boolean onCreateOptionsMenu(Menu): 添加菜单(返回,注销,更新信息)这个功能应当用于登录之后的每一个页面...; import android.app.Activity; import android.content.Context; import android.content.Intent; import...; import androidx.core.content.ContextCompat; import android.Manifest; import android.app.Activity; import

1.3K40

_Android 课设之个人音乐播放器

第一章 绪论1.1选题背景由于时代快速发展,各种各样的音乐播放器层出不穷,此时需要一个可以根据个人爱好来播放的音乐播放器就尤为重要,因此我特意制作了一个根据自己喜好的音乐播放器,只需要把音乐文件放进制定的目录下即可...1.2开发技术该App利用了SQlite数据库对于用户的管理,还有MediaPlayer媒体播放器的使用,和各种布局加以一些控件得以使界面看着舒服,还有利用了广播信息对于用户的操作进行提示。...Protect void onCreate(Bundle): 构建播放音乐界面Public boolean onCreateOptionsMenu(Menu): 添加菜单(返回,注销,更新信息)这个功能应当用于登录之后的每一个页面...;import android.app.Activity;import android.content.Context;import android.content.Intent;import android.content.pm.PackageManager...;import androidx.core.content.ContextCompat;import android.Manifest;import android.app.Activity;import

21310

hexo-tag-aplayer音乐插件使用

,引入 MetingJS 后,播放器将支持对于 QQ音乐、网易云音乐、虾米、酷狗、百度等平台的音乐播放。...: vim source/music/index.md #添加以下代码 {% meting "1983872197" "netease" "playlist" "autoplay" "mutex:false...volume 0.7 播放器音量 lrctype 0 歌词格式类型 listfolded false 指定音乐播放列表是否折叠 storagename metingjs LocalStorage 中存储播放器设定的键名...播放列表的最大长度 preload auto 音乐文件预载入模式,可选项: none, metadata, auto theme #ad7a86 播放器风格色彩设置 插件会在每一個文件都插入 js 和...根目錄_config 里配置 asset_inject 为 false aplayer: asset_inject: false 然後在你需要使用 aplayer 的页面 Front-matter 添加

1.3K20

【大结局】《从案例中学习JavaScript》之酷炫音乐播放器(四)

Paste_Image.png 这是之前写的用H5制作的音乐播放器,前三节其实已经做得差不多了,音轨的制作原理已经在上一节说明,不过一直还没有和音乐对接。...给body添加一个线性背景 body { background:-webkit-linear-gradient(top,skyblue 0%,#fff 100%) no-repeat;...用audio标签播放音乐 生成默认的audio对象,然后添加到body区域 var audio = document.createElement('audio'); audio.src = 'mp3/01...window.msRequestAnimationFrame; //2:初始化音轨对象 var audioContext = new window.AudioContext(); var flag = null; //控制是否解析的开关变量 //拿到播放器去解析音乐文件...演示站点 您的支持是我写作的最大动力: 嗯,音乐播放器系列到此为止就算是结束了,感谢各位的捧场。

99150

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券